"Easy to set up and use" I bought 4 of these (3rd gen, now renamed the "Outdoor Camera") to use at my parents' house. I don't have experience with… Read more
other similar products but I am a bit surprised by the negative reviews here. I found it easy to set up with the app and in my opinion it mostly has a "just right" feature set. Specifically, it waits to detect motion and then captures a minute of video and sends you an alert. You can also go to the app or website and view the camera live. You can set it to take a photo every few minutes or hour. You can also turn on a "siren" (which is a bit of a joke, it's not very loud) and talk through the camera.
In our case, this is perfect. I don't want constant video feed, I just need to know if something happens. I want to keep bandwidth usage down because this might end up being on a mobile broadband with somewhat limited data. So the way these work seems perfect to me.
A lot of reviews complain about the subscription. I guess I'm not sure how anyone could not know about that, but yes, it's an ongoing monthly or yearly fee. I'm still on the trial but will just sign up for the $150/year plan. Like anything, factor it in before making a purchasing decision. I decided the convenience was worth the cost, ymmv.
Some reviewers complain about motion detection - the settings are quite adjustable here, you can tell it where in the field of view to check for motion, and whether it looks only for a person, person or vehicle, or any movement. There's also a sensitivity setting. The only one I've had to adjust so far is the doorbell, which is not the item in this review anyway. There's a slight delay before the captured video starts but I think it's still effective.
The cameras can only record over the Internet, which is fine with me, I don't think I want to muck around with SD cards.
Initially I thought it wasn't possible to just disable and re-enable all cameras easily i.e. single click. It turns out that it is, but you have to specifically turn on "Modes" in the app. I'm not sure why this isn't on by default, but anyway, the feature is there and it works great once you figure it out.
Right now a 4-pack of these is $249 or $62.50 each, so even after you factor in the subscription, this seems like pretty good value to me, without having to muck about with cables, SD cards or a local server or whatever.

Reliable, feature rich product – Our DCS-5222L has been serving us more than 2.5 years now. When we first bought it, we had problems with firmware updates and that rendered the… Read more
camera inoperable and we had it replaced. We don't jump to the first chance of upgrading firmware anymore. This copy has been reliable and my dogs haven't destroyed it. That says something.
No, it is not for outdoors, it is not vandal proof, it is a bit bulky. But on the plus side, there are plenty of them! It tilts-n-pans. You can preset several camera positions and jump to them quickly. It records to microSD card, it is backed by mobile app and we can watch it anywhere. It can take still snaps or videos clips, it can do two-way audio. Of course the sound volume straight out of the camera is low and sounds like an old telephone. But I have conversed with my wife using it before. It does work. It doesn't auto focus, nor does it do optical zoom. But given its small sensor, depth of view is pretty big and is good enough for indoors. It is HD but not full HD, limited at 720p. It does audio and motion detection and it does email notification.
We are very happy with it. If it wasn't because we had to return the first copy and firmware issues we had at the beginning, I would have given it 5 stars. It is not small like some of the newer products in the market. So it isn't inconspicuous.

A good camera, but expensive to use – I wanted a decent camera that could replace my often unreliable smart phones that were acting as security cameras. I found Imou to have good… Read more
ratings, pretty good feedback, and was priced well, around AUD$80 for two cameras. Once they arrived, one had a faulty power adaptor, the seller responded quickly and within a week they sent a replacement. Setting up the camera was pretty straight forward, it had a Q code which made it pretty easy. Once I set up both cameras I discovered that without a subscription, the cameras was pretty pointless. So I signed up one camera for 3 months to see how they worked.
With a subscription, the camera is great, it senses movement, sends you an alert, and you can view the footage and download it to your phone. However, without a subscription, all you get is the alert and a tiny thumbnail with no detail visible. When you try to play the video, you are directed to buy a subscription. So, you can use the camera without paying, and you will get an alert, but you cannot see what set the camera off unless you install an SD card into each camera. Then you can view the footage. Once the SD card fills up, oldest footage gets deleted. So either chose a less space gobbling recording setting, like 720 instead of 1080, and buy a 64Gb SD card.
Also, I found the cloud option with the subscription is very handy, and works well, however the amount of data uploaded was gigabytes from a little wind storm and decimated my data allowance on the internet account. So I bought a 128gb SD card to install in the camera. Doing this saves footage to the camera's SD card, no need for the cloud. So how much is the subscription? I am charged AUD$4.80 per month for one camera, AUD$8.99 for two cameras, and AUD$13 for 3 cameras per month. So AUD$107 for two cameras a year. It is a good camera, night vision is really good, so far they have not missed a beat... but with Alfred x camera I am paying AUD$45 a year for as many smart phones I can connect. With Imou I am essentially renting each camera. Yet for around $300, one off price, I could have bought some standalone cameras and a recorder... sigh.
For people that don't mind paying per month, Imou is a good system and offers a good service, or if you want to buy an SD card for each camera instead, then Imou becomes good value.
